Barbara Windsor Admits She Burst Into Tears While Filming Her Final EastEnders Episode

Barbara Windsor broke down in tears as she described her final scenes as Peggy Mitchell in EastEnders.

Dame Barbara, 78, in the BBC soap for 22 years, says she also cried making her last episode.

Talking to ITV’s Good Morning Britain, the actress, below and pictured meeting the Queen on the set of EastEnders, said: “I did my crying afterwards.

“Peggy’s quite tough and I hope people will accept the way I played her with cancer.”

Peggy’s death will be broadcast next week, with Ross Kemp returning as her TV son Grant Mitchell for the scenes.

Producer Dominic Treadwell-Collins said: “Barbara gives the performance of her life. The last episode will break your heart.”
